Undocking of USS Cole to occur 15 September

USS COLE will be re-launched on 15 September 2001 from a floating dry dock at Northrop Grumman Ship Systems' Ingalls Operations, Pascagoula, MS. The ship will be moved to a nearby outfitting pier for completion of remaining work and will be returned to the Fleet in April 2002. The Naval Sea Systems Command's Supervisor of Shipbuilding, Conversion, and Repair, Pascagoula, MS (SUPSHIP) oversaw the restoration effort that commenced in March of this year, following the ship's return to the United States. Work aboard COLE consisted of structural repairs to replace areas damaged in the 12 October 2000 explosion in Aden, replacement of damaged or unserviceable equipment, and removal and evaluation and/or re-certification of critical systems such as shafting and propellers.
